“This place is paramount in fighting hunger in an area. They serve breakfast to go Monday to Friday 9am-10am. They also serve a to go lunch from noon -1pm. A dine in dinner is served at a seat a one of the large round tables from 5:30pm to 7pm. After 6:30pm they offer an additional meal to go.”
